
2515 E Glenn Ave, Auburn, AL 36830, USA
2515 East Glenn Avenue Auburn Alabama 36830 US

The business is based in the USA, where engineers also design, construct, and store all of the components.

cryoexel-cryotherapy-manufacturer-1024x498.jpg 2 years ago
  • You must to post comments
Showing 1 result

No entries were found.

Showing 0 results